Output 659e30fec591cdb64c4ed36e7e6ef387c15c4dcb779b2a9024faad7d5f519960:0
- value
- 30403488
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17abf3511e109150d8f923ba95329e92d0bd0165 OP_EQUAL
- address
- 33rBTHNLfByEw6T7YZGdFo9azLWuhoP1sC
- transaction
- 659e30fec591cdb64c4ed36e7e6ef387c15c4dcb779b2a9024faad7d5f519960
- spent
- true